Changhe Z-8J Helicopter 3D Model
The Changhe Z-8 (Zhishengji-8) is a triple engine, multi-role helicopter designed and manufactured by the Changhe Aircraft Industry Group (CAIG) of China. It is derived from SA 321 Super Frelon Helicopter built by Aerospatiale. The helicopter entered service in 1989. About 15 to 20 Z-8 helicopters are currently serving the People’s Liberation Army Naval Air Force (PLANAF). The Z-8J is a ship-borne variant of Z-8 capable of landing on water. Z-8J and Z-8J are currently in service with PLANAF, executing transport and medical evacuation operations respectively.
